Stable page number and hidden flows

I am running KOreader 2025.10 on a rooted PW4, but have also reproduced this with 2025.10 on Linux. I just started playing with stable page numbers and found something that looks wrong.

If I have stable page numbers turned OFF, and set up and enable a custom hidden flow, several things change in the status bar: the progress percentage and the total # of pages change, and the '/' current/total page separator changes to '//'.

If I turn ON stable page numbers, and then enable/disable a custom hidden flow, the only status bar field that changes is the progress percentage - the total page count does NOT change to reflect the hidden flow, and the page separator never changes to '//'.

Also, with stable page numbers enabled, the page numbers for TOC entries in a hidden flow don't show the hidden flow page number in [ ] the way they do if stable page numbers is off.

This isn't supposed to work like this, is it?

Yes, stable pages prevail hidden flows.

Ok, if that's the way it's supposed to work, but that seems counter-intuitive to me. Stable page numbers can be set up to apply "globally", to all books that haven't already been opened with non-stable pages.

By its nature, a custom flow is specific to a single book, and I would expect that to override the page type for that book.

I also don't understand why it changes only the percent progress and not the total pages in the book. With the status bar like this, current page/total pages is not equal to the displayed percentage.
